How much does it cost to rent a home in Altona?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Altona 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,165 | $1,100 | $3,050 |
Altona 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,022 | $1,900 | $3,600 |
Altona 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,740 | $2,800 | $4,000 |
Altona 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,975 | $4,975 | $4,975 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Altona
What type of rentals are currently available in Altona?
There are currently 45 Apartments for Rent in Altona, NY with pricing that ranges from $1,341 to $6,200. There are also 32 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Altona ranging from $1,100 to $4,975.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Altona?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Altona ranges from $1,100 to $4,975 with an average monthly rent of $2,869.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Altona?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Altona range from $1,675 to $3,000,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,900 to $3,600.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,800 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,775.
